Watch: Pacific Coast Highway Devastated by Flooding & Mudslides

A powerful atmospheric river swept through California on Thursday, bringing intense rainfall that triggered flooding and mudslides in areas recently scorched by the Eaton and Palisades wildfires.

Malibu Hit Hard by Mud and Debris

Among the hardest-hit regions was Malibu, where mud and debris overwhelmed parts of the Pacific Coast Highway (PCH) and surrounding neighborhoods.

Local photographer Alexandra Datig captured video footage showing the extent of the destruction. In the clip, she narrates:

“This is PCH near Malibu’s city limits. There’s a massive debris flow spilling onto the highway and into the ocean right here in the burn zone.”
